Output 3dea400502a706282389dc22da54057d2917b94caca6b576b226a35748f69471:0

value
4390069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aa7ac3c990442ed3c05883c7f9c2e99c23b6e94 OP_EQUAL
address
35aZAiC2ZGSWohQbi8666VcbfgEZXXGFtx
transaction
3dea400502a706282389dc22da54057d2917b94caca6b576b226a35748f69471
confirmations
422599
spent
true